site stats

Creating index on sql table

WebFeb 28, 2024 · Click the plus sign to expand the table on which you want to create an index with nonkey columns. Right-click the Indexes folder, point to New Index , and select Non … WebTo create a new index for a table, you use the CREATE INDEX statement as follows: CREATE INDEX index_name ON table_name (column1 [,column2,...]) Code language: SQL (Structured Query Language) (sql) In this syntax: First, specify the name of the index.

Solved **************************************SQL Chegg.com

WebNov 12, 2014 · Top 10 Steps to Building Useful Database Indexes 1. Index by workload, not by table Many people make the mistake of just guessing at some indexes to create when they are creating database tables. Without an idea of how the tables are going to be accessed, though, these guesses are often wrong – at least some of them. WebNov 14, 2024 · dbtut November 14, 2024 MSSQL, TSQL Before SQL Server 2014, we were able to create an index in two ways by right-clicking on SSMS and clicking new index, or using the tsql script. But we couldn’t create index as we create primary key or foreign key in the CREATE TABLE statement. cornerstone low income apartments https://qandatraders.com

Creating Indexes with SQL Server Management Studio

WebNov 18, 2024 · You can create a partitioned table or index in SQL Server, Azure SQL Database, and Azure SQL Managed Instance by using SQL Server Management Studio or Transact-SQL. The data in partitioned tables and indexes is horizontally divided into units that can be spread across more than one filegroup in a database, or stored in a single … WebIndexing a gender field (M/F) is of very little use, it's just as practical to scan the table and find the ~50% that match. If it's listed after something more specific in the index (e.g. [date of birth, gender]) that's better - you might want all Males born in a given time span. WebFeb 28, 2024 · Using SQL Server Management Studio To create an index with nonkey columns In Object Explorer, click the plus sign to expand the database that contains the table on which you want to create an index with nonkey columns. Click the plus sign to expand the Tables folder. cornerstone lumberton nj

sql-server - How many indexes can we create on a SQL Server table ...

Category:SQL - Show indexes - TutorialsPoint

Tags:Creating index on sql table

Creating index on sql table

SQL CREATE INDEX Statement - W3School

WebMay 12, 2024 · In this article. Recommendations and examples for indexing tables in dedicated SQL pool in Azure Synapse Analytics. Index types. Dedicated SQL pool offers … WebQ1.Create a clustered index ix_ss_brand on the brand column of the sales.sales_summary table. Copy and paste your SQL statement to create the index below. Q2. Create a nonclustered index ix_ss_cover on the table such that it is a covering index for the following query and an index seek (nonclustered) operation will be used in the execution …

Creating index on sql table

Did you know?

WebJul 28, 2024 · If you truly want to REBUILD, and you want to do it for ALL indexes on a given table, then the command would be (straight from the official docs that npe pointed you at): For more instructions see the official docs. The link points to SQL Server 2014 docs, but the syntax should work on 2005 and 2008 as well. WebThe CREATE INDEX command consists of the keywords "CREATE INDEX" followed by the name of the new index, the keyword "ON", the name of a previously created table that is to be indexed, and a parenthesized list of table column names and/or expressions that are used for the index key.

WebSQL CREATE INDEX Statement SQL CREATE INDEX Statement. The CREATE INDEX statement is used to create indexes in tables. Indexes are used to retrieve... CREATE INDEX Example. DROP INDEX Statement. The DROP INDEX statement is used to … SQL DEFAULT on CREATE TABLE. The following SQL sets a DEFAULT value … SQL UNIQUE Constraint. The UNIQUE constraint ensures that all values in a … SQL CHECK Constraint. The CHECK constraint is used to limit the value … SQL PRIMARY KEY Constraint. The PRIMARY KEY constraint uniquely … In SQL, a view is a virtual table based on the result-set of an SQL statement. A … sql_variant: Stores up to 8,000 bytes of data of various data types, except text, … SQL FOREIGN KEY Constraint. The FOREIGN KEY constraint is used to … W3Schools offers free online tutorials, references and exercises in all the major … SQL Create DB SQL Drop DB SQL Backup DB SQL Create Table SQL Drop Table … W3Schools offers free online tutorials, references and exercises in all the major … WebThe constraint is also checked during the execution of the CREATE INDEX statement. If the table already contains rows with duplicate key values, the index is not created. ... Index …

WebFeb 28, 2024 · In Object Explorer, expand the table on which you want to create a clustered index. Right-click the Indexes folder, point to New Index, and select Clustered Index.... In the New Index dialog box, on the General page, enter the name of the new index in the Index name box. Under Index key columns, click Add....

WebAug 10, 2024 · create index upper_names_i on table ( upper ( name ) ); You can use functions in bitmap or B-tree indexes. Bear in mind if you have a function-based index, …

WebCREATE INDEX constructs an index on the specified column (s) of the specified table. Indexes are primarily used to enhance database performance (though inappropriate use can result in slower performance). The key field (s) for the index are specified as column names, or alternatively as expressions written in parentheses. fanruan certified associateWebAug 20, 2024 · Right click on Indexes and we can see an option to create a New Index. Select Clustered Index... as shown below. A new index creation window will appear as … cornerstone lutheran carmel indianaWebSQL Create Index - An SQL index is an effective way to quickly retrieve data from a database. Indexing a table or view can significantly improve query and application performance. Though indexes help accelerate search queries, users are not able to directly see these indexes in action. cornerstone lynchburg apartmentsWebMar 20, 2024 · Clustered columnstore index (CCI) is the default for creating tables in Azure Synapse Analytics. Data in CCI is not sorted before being compressed into columnstore segments. When creating a CCI with ORDER, data is sorted before being added to index segments and query performance can be improved. fan run by heatWebThe easiest way to create an index is to go to Object Explorer, locate the table, right-click on it, go to the New index, and then click the Non-Clustered index command: This will open the New index window in which we can click the Add button on the lower right to add a column to this index: cornerstone machineWebA SQL index is like the index of a book. It speeds up the retrieval of a record. The relational database management system (RDBMS) can retrieve a record with the index key instead of having to perform a table scan. MySQL automatically creates indexes for primary and foreign keys significantly speeding up join performance. You should only create ... cornerstone lutheran carmelWebYou have to create one. In this case, I'd suggest either of these. It depends on relative selectivity of the 2 columns CREATE INDEX IX_table2fk ON table1 (t2_col1, t1_col3) INCLUDE (any columns needed for the query) OR CREATE INDEX IX_table2fk ON table1 (t1_col3, t2_col1) INCLUDE (any columns needed for the query) fan run by battery